Which Siding Type Has the Longest Lifespan Under Midwest Weather Conditions?

Fiber cement siding generally offers the longest lifespan in the Midwest due to its cement–sand–cellulose composition, which resists rot, pests, deformation, and moisture absorption. When properly installed and maintained, fiber cement can last 40 to 50 years or more, even in Iowa’s freeze–thaw conditions and high-humidity summers.

Engineered wood siding also performs well and is manufactured to resist swelling, decay, and impact damage. Its treated wood fibers provide significantly better dimensional stability than traditional wood siding. When maintained according to manufacturer guidelines, engineered wood siding frequently lasts 30 years or longer.

Vinyl siding generally lasts 20 to 30 years, depending on its grade and exposure conditions. While not susceptible to rot, moisture, or corrosion, vinyl can crack in extremely cold temperatures and warp under excessive heat. Higher-quality, insulated vinyl products tend to offer longer service life than lower-grade alternatives.

What Are the Maintenance Differences Between Vinyl, Engineered Wood, and Fiber Cement?

Vinyl siding has the lowest maintenance burden and requires only periodic washing to remove dirt, dust, and pollen. It never requires painting, and modern UV-resistant formulations help prevent fading. Homeowners typically need only inspect vinyl panels for cracking or displacement after severe storms.

Engineered wood siding requires moderate maintenance. It must be repainted or refinished periodically—often every 5 to 10 years, depending on exposure and the quality of the finish. Maintaining caulking and sealing around joints helps prevent moisture penetration and preserves the siding’s durability.

Fiber cement siding requires minimal routine maintenance but must be repainted periodically to maintain its protective finish. Homeowners generally need to repaint every 10 to 15 years. Cleaning, checking caulking, and ensuring proper drainage around the home further extend its lifespan. The material’s weight and working requirements mean professional installation is essential to avoid long-term issues.

How Does Cost Per Square Foot Differ Among These Materials?

Vinyl siding is typically the most affordable option. It offers the lowest installation cost per square foot while still providing strong performance for Iowa’s climate. Premium and insulated vinyl products increase costs slightly but remain cost-effective.

Engineered wood siding falls into a mid-range price bracket. Material and installation costs are higher than vinyl but lower than fiber cement. The improved durability, enhanced wood-grain appearance, and customizable finish options contribute to the higher cost.

Fiber cement siding typically carries the highest upfront cost among the three. The material itself is more expensive, and installation requires specialized tools and trained installers, which further increases the total project cost. Its long lifespan and strong climate resilience often justify the initial investment.

What Are the Environmental Impacts of Each Siding Material?

Vinyl siding uses petroleum-based materials and can produce emissions during manufacturing. However, modern processes are more efficient, and many manufacturers now produce recyclable or partially recycled vinyl products. Longevity also helps reduce total lifecycle impact.

Engineered wood siding generally offers a favorable environmental profile. It uses fast-growing wood fibers, reducing reliance on old-growth timber, and many products incorporate recycled or sustainably sourced materials. Its biodegradability and efficient manufacturing processes contribute positively to environmental performance.

Fiber cement siding has a higher manufacturing energy requirement due to cement production, but offers long-term environmental advantages because of its extended lifespan and stability. It does not release harmful chemicals, and some regions support recycling programs for fiber cement waste, though this varies by location.

How Does Curb Appeal Differ Across Vinyl, Engineered Wood, and Fiber Cement?

Vinyl siding offers versatile style options, including traditional lap, shakes, scallops, and vertical patterns. Modern manufacturing techniques provide improved texture and deeper color palettes. Premium vinyl can deliver a more refined appearance, though it typically has a more uniform surface than engineered wood or fiber cement.

Engineered wood siding delivers a natural, authentic wood-grain aesthetic that appeals to homeowners seeking warmth and architectural character. It is well-suited to craftsman, traditional, and custom home designs. Paint and stain options allow for high customization, giving engineered wood strong curb appeal.

Fiber cement siding offers a balanced aesthetic, combining design versatility with long-term stability. It can convincingly replicate traditional wood textures or provide smooth, modern finishes suitable for contemporary homes. Because fiber cement holds paint well and resists deformation, it maintains crisp lines and a consistent appearance over time, making it an excellent choice for enhancing resale value.
